调用DescribeRouteConflict查询网络实例中存在冲突的路由条目。

调试

您可以在OpenAPI Explorer中直接运行该接口,免去您计算签名的困扰。运行成功后,OpenAPI Explorer可以自动生成SDK代码示例。

请求参数

名称 类型 是否必选 示例值 描述
Action String DescribeRouteConflict

要执行的操作,取值:DescribeRouteConflict

ChildInstanceId String vpc-bp18sth14qii3pn****

要查询的冲突路由所属的网络实例的ID。

ChildInstanceRegionId String cn-hangzhou

网络实例所属的地域的ID。

ChildInstanceRouteTableId String vtb-bp174d1gje79u1g4t****

要查询的冲突路由所属的路由表的ID。

ChildInstanceType String VBR

网络实例的类型,取值:

  • VPC:专有网络。
  • VBR:边界路由器。
  • CCN:中国内地云连接网。
PageNumber Integer 1

列表的页码,默认值为1

PageSize Integer 2

分页查询时每页的行数,最大值为50,默认值为10

DestinationCidrBlock String 172.16.XX.XX/24

要查询的冲突路由的目标网段。

返回数据

名称 类型 示例值 描述
PageNumber Integer 1

当前页码。

PageSize Integer 1

每页包含的条目数。

RequestId String B6C11547-2D56-4EEC-A8D5-FDC5A53E53D0

请求ID。

RouteConflicts Array

冲突路由条目的详细信息。

RouteConflict
DestinationCidrBlock String 172.16.XX.XX/24

冲突路由的目标网段。

InstanceId String vbr-bp174d1gje79u1****

网络实例ID。

InstanceType String VBR

网络实例的类型。

  • VPC:专有网络。
  • VBR:边界路由器。
  • CCN:中国内地云连接网。
RegionId String cn-hangzhou

地域ID。

Status String conflict

产生路由异常的原因: 取值:

  • conflict:路由冲突。
  • overflow:其他网络实例路由表路由数量超出限制。
  • prohibited:VBR策略不允许的默认路由。
TotalCount Integer 2

列表条目数。

示例

请求示例

http(s)://[Endpoint]/?Action=DescribeRouteConflict
&ChildInstanceId=vpc-bp18sth14qii3pn****
&ChildInstanceRegionId=cn-hangzhou
&ChildInstanceRouteTableId=vtb-bp174d1gje79u1g4t****
&ChildInstanceType=VBR
&<公共请求参数>

正常返回示例

XML 格式

<DescribeRouteConflictResponse>
      <PageNumber>1</PageNumber>
      <PageSize>10</PageSize>
      <RequestId>B6C11547-2D56-4EEC-A8D5-FDC5A53E53D0</RequestId>
      <RouteConflicts>
            <RouteConflict></RouteConflict>
      </RouteConflicts>
      <TotalCount>0</TotalCount>
</DescribeRouteConflictResponse>

JSON 格式

{
  "PageNumber": 1,
  "TotalCount": 0,
  "PageSize": 10,
  "RequestId": "B6C11547-2D56-4EEC-A8D5-FDC5A53E53D0",
  "RouteConflicts": {
    "RouteConflict": []
  }
}

错误码

访问错误中心查看更多错误码。